Output 65c6bf95321f1a2578e5468265c529ae053a5241f02dc210f41539a08afc6b6b:1

value
1989999670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5e693508b8ffa93704fe1df6407a7a9ecf5534b OP_EQUAL
address
3JGpSvn9qqdzWNpheMje3Paw1ADzhJfPLk
transaction
65c6bf95321f1a2578e5468265c529ae053a5241f02dc210f41539a08afc6b6b
spent
true